Include files don't get compiled when they are part of a class or program they are "sucked" into the program and compiled inside the program which goes and replaces all the #defines with what was in the include file. Nothing states that you can't manually compile an include file to create an FXP but it will just be like if you created a PRG that all was in it was #defines.
